When engaging in open dialogue about solutions, it is important to validate children's emotions and perspectives. By actively listening to children without judgment and showing empathy towards their experiences, adults can foster trust and communication. Encouraging children to brainstorm possible solutions to their problems and discussing the potential outcomes can empower them to make informed decisions and build their confidence in navigating emotional situations. Ultimately, fostering an open dialogue about solutions can equip children with the skills to manage their emotions effectively and cultivate healthy relationships with others. Establishing Daily Calming Routines
Establishing daily calming routines is essential in fostering emotional intelligence in young children. By incorporating consistent practices that promote relaxation and mindfulness, children can develop the necessary skills to regulate their emotions effectively. These routines provide a sense of predictability and stability, aiding children in managing stress and building resilience from a young age. A structured bedtime routine, such as reading a soothing story or engaging in gentle stretching exercises before sleep, can help children unwind and transition to a state of relaxation. Additionally, incorporating mindfulness activities like deep breathing exercises or guided imagery during the day can teach children how to pause and reflect on their feelings, promoting self-awareness and emotional regulation. Building these daily calming routines not only supports children in navigating their emotions but also establishes healthy habits that can benefit their overall well-being.
